Broken Wings, Theatre Royal Haymarket

Image result for broken wings, theatre royal haymarket

by guest critic Amy Toledano

It is rare that a new musical has the kind of oomph that Broken Wings has in a run lasting just four days. This show has shown that a brilliant cast, outstanding musicians and phenomenal score can create true magic.
